  • Ascending neurons provide sensory and motor feedback to the brain, whereas descending neurons carry sensory and motor-related information from the brain to central pattern generators in the posterior ganglia. (springer.com)
  • Descending neurons can thus initiate and modify behavior based on sensory input, and other higher order processing that takes place in the brain. (springer.com)
  • Indeed, orchestrating complex behavior using only 1100 descending neurons (Hsu and Bhandawat 2016 ), requires efficient integration of sensory input and motor output, as well as higher-order processing, such as learning. (springer.com)

  • Caenorhabditis elegans senses and navigates its complex chemical environment using a small subset of sensory neurons [ 22 - 24 ]. (plos.org)
  • The valence of individual chemicals is largely determined by the responding sensory neuron type, such that distinct subsets of chemosensory neurons drive either attraction or avoidance to different chemicals [ 25 , 26 ]. (plos.org)
